jQuery中的after()方法可以用来插入新元素,它会将新元素插入到选定元素的后面,而不会替换掉选定元素。这是一个非常有用的方法,可以让我们更轻松地添加新元素,而不用手动去替换已有的元素。
在使用after()方法插入新元素之前,需要使用jQuery选择器来选择想要插入新元素的位置。选择器可以是元素的ID,也可以是元素的类名,还可以是元素的标签名等等,只要能够定位到想要插入新元素的位置即可。
就可以使用after()方法来插入新元素了。after()方法的语法如下:
$(selector).after(content);
其中,selector是上面选择器选择的位置,content是想要插入的新元素的内容,可以是HTML代码,也可以是jQuery对象,还可以是DOM元素等等。
下面是一个使用after()方法插入新元素的示例:
$('#myDiv').after('<p>This is a new paragraph.</p>');
上面的代码中,我们使用ID选择器#myDiv来选择#myDiv元素,使用after()方法将一个新的段落<p>This is a new paragraph.</p>插入到#myDiv元素的后面。
after()方法还可以接受一个函数作为参数,函数的参数是当前元素,函数的返回值作为新元素的内容。例如:
$('#myDiv').after(function(index){ return '<p>This is the ' + (index + 1) + ' paragraph.</p>'; });
上面的代码中,我们使用after()方法来插入新的段落,新段落的内容是由函数返回的,函数的参数是当前元素的索引,我们可以根据索引来设置新段落的内容。
jQuery的after()方法是一个非常有用的方法,可以让我们更轻松地插入新元素,而不用手动去替换已有的元素。
本文链接:http://task.lmcjl.com/news/13256.html